Drowned City: Hurricane Katrina and New Orleans by Don Brown

3.0

Engaging description of Hurricane Katrina and the events during the week after its landfall near New Orleans. Failures of governmental services as well as accounts of people working tirelessly to help others are described using quotes and facts. This book could be especially interesting for students wondering about how recent (2017) hurricanes may have affected populations in Houston, Puerto Rico, and Caribbean islands.
